Product Parameters
| Parameter Category | Specifications |
|---|---|
| Brand & Model | GE IC695NKT001 |
| Product Type | Network Keying Module for GE RX3i Series PLC |
| Security Features | Hardware-based authentication, configuration locking, user access partitioning, audit logging |
| Keying Modes | Local keying, network keying, enterprise-level centralized keying |
| Authentication Methods | USB key authentication, password protection, role-based access control (RBAC) |
| Audit Log Capacity | 10,000 event logs (non-volatile storage, retrievable via GE software) |
| Communication Interface | 1 x USB 2.0 port (for local key management); 1 x RJ45 Ethernet port (for network key sync) |
| Operating Temperature | -40°C to 75°C |
| Storage Temperature | -55°C to 85°C |
| Power Consumption | 2.2 W typical (24 VDC input) |
| Input Voltage | 24 VDC (18-36 VDC input range) |
| Compatibility | Fully compatible with all GE RX3i CPU modules, control racks, and communication modules |
| Form Factor | Rack-mounted (single-slot design for RX3i 3U rack units) |
| Dimensions (W x H x D) | 44 mm x 132 mm x 310 mm |
| Certifications | UL 508, CE, ATEX, IEC 61131-2, ISO 9001, IEC 62443 (industrial cybersecurity) compliant |
| Weight | 0.45 kg |

Selection Suggestions and Precautions
- Selection Suggestions:
- Choose the GE IC695NKT001 for RX3i PLC systems handling proprietary logic, critical processes, or regulated operations (aerospace, pharma, energy) where security and compliance are top priorities.
- Opt for this module if you need centralized security management across distributed facilities, as its enterprise keying mode supports large-scale industrial networks.
- Prioritize the GE IC695NKT001 for harsh environment deployments, thanks to its rugged design that outperforms temperature-sensitive competing modules.
- Precautions:
- Ensure the module is installed in a GE RX3i 3U rack unit and paired with compatible RX3i CPU modules to avoid security function malfunctions.
- Verify the input voltage stays within the 18-36 VDC range to protect the module’s internal security components.
- Regularly back up the audit log via GE software to prevent data loss once the 10,000-event capacity is reached.
- Store USB authentication keys in a secure location, as lost keys may require factory reset of the module (which erases local security settings).
- Avoid exposing the module to direct moisture or corrosive gases, even with industrial-grade protection, to preserve the integrity of hardware authentication components.
